since DefaultIfEmpty() is not supported, what is the proper way of doing a left join?

    in the end, I used the let way with .FirstOrDefault()

    from myothertable
    where....
    let var = (query).FirstOrDefault()
    select new {otherfield, var.field1, var.field2}
